Failure of bio-metric machine stalls payment of N5, 000 stipends in Kwara– Official

Date: 2017-03-04

Mrs Aminat Yahya, the Director, Conditional Cash Transfer Scheme in Kwara , said failure of the biometric machine stalled the payment of the Federal Government's N5,000 stipends beneficiaries in Kwara.

Yahya told the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) in Ilorin on Friday, that the exercise ran into a hitch in Isin and Oke-Ero Local Government Areas of the state#, adding that the machine went bad when it was being used to pay farmers in the two areas.

She also said that thumb prints of farmers were not captured easily in the biometric data due to the nature of their occupation.

"Farmers' thumbs, especially in Isin and Oke-Ero and some other areas, too, could not be thoroughly captured. "The development is posing serious challenge to the success of the capturing exercise.

"For now, we can't pay some and leave others out. We won't be achieving uniformity in that sense," she said.

She further said that bank officials had returned to the affected communities to recapture those whose fingerprints and passport photographs did not appear boldly in the data bank.

Yahya assured the beneficiaries that payment would begin after they had been grouped into various cooperatives for rotational savings and the problem rectified.

"We have a monitoring team and facilitators saddled with the responsibility of ensuring that the funds acquired by beneficiaries are invested in businesses they identified." NAN reports that Conditional Cash Transfer Scheme is meant to uplift the poor in the country.NAN
